3 February 2026Hort Innovation’s Industry Services Managers Mark Spees and Chris O’Connor are currently consulting with AUSVEG, and the wider grower community to identify key investment and research priorities for the next 12-months and beyond. During February 2026, they are going out to growers nationally to seek input on how Vegetable, Onion, and Potato levy funds are invested for the benefit of the industry.
With significant levy funds forecast for research and investment over the next five years, your feedback as growers is vital to guide what the final strategic investment plan will include and the focus for new project investments.

With many local growers speaking languages other than English, it is important to make it as easy as possible for the grower community to have their say on the priorities that matter to them. That is why the vegetable grower survey has been translated into five common grower languages
When growers open the vegetable industry survey, they can click on the language button in the right-hand corner, and a drop-down menu will link to five survey options in languages other than English.
- Vietnamese
- Punjabi
- Khmer
- Chinese (simplified)
- Arabic
